More pictures: https://forum.roboteers.org/gallery/index.php?album/29-arduino-ants/ Build blog in German language: https://forum.roboteers.org/index.php?thread/6449-arduino-ants-aa/&pageNo=1 Printed parts: Chassis: Prusament PETG Shovel: Renkforce ABS Wheels: Form Futura PP Drive Motor bearings: PLA (printed with 0.2mm nozzle. See https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:5244821) (not mandatory, without the bearings the N10s can also be swapped for N20s) Non printed parts: Wheel surface: 3M grip tape glued on with superglue Bottom plate: 1mm random plastic cut to size with a knife. Chassis can be used as a template. Drive Motor bearings: 3x6x2 bearing (3 mm inner radius, 6 mm outer radius, 2 mm width) Drive motors: N10 from Nuts & Bots (without the bearings the N10s can also be swapped for N20s) Drive ESC: Dual ESC from BristolBotBuilders Lifter Servo: Servo from BristolBotBuilders Receiver: Arduino Nano and NRF24L01 SMD 2.4GHz module (There are several youtube tutorials on how to build a transmitter and receiver with this.) Battery: 2S 700maH LiPo made from two single cells (can be swapped for anything comparable) Zipties to hold the drive motors in place. A few small screws. On-Off Switch Voltmeter display (optional)
